# 20.710 Rule 710. Expenses of appellants, representatives, and witnesses incident to hearings not reimbursable by the Government.

No expenses incurred by an appellant, representative, or witness incident to attendance at a hearing may be paid by the Government.

(Authority: 38 U.S.C. 111)

[57 FR 4109, Feb. 3, 1992. Redesignated and amended at 84 FR 187, Jan. 18, 2019]
